Базис HTML и CSS для дебютантов

Базис HTML и CSS для дебютантов

HTML и CSS составляют собой фундаментальные инструменты веб-разработки. HTML ответственен за построение и наполнение страницы, а CSS контролирует зрительным дизайном элементов. Овладение этих языков предоставляет возможность к созданию порталов.

HTML расшифровывается как HyperText Markup Language. Язык разметки использует теги для определения вида контента. Браузер интерпретирует теги и отображает содержимое соответственно заданной построению.

CSS означает Cascading Style Sheets. Каскадные таблицы стилей позволяют разграничить содержание и представление. Программист может скорректировать внешний облик всего портала, отредактировав единственный файл стилей.

Изучение платинум казино нуждается последовательного способа. Начинающим рекомендуется изначально освоить фундаментальные теги разметки. После усвоения организации документа можно переходить к оформлению элементов.

Современные браузеры поддерживают современные нормы языков. Инструменты разработчика внедрены в Chrome, Firefox и другие браузеры. Консоль браузера позволяет отслеживать код и изучать Платинум Казино на реальных случаях.

Построение HTML‑документа: doctype, head, body и базовый макет страницы

Каждый HTML-документ начинается с объявления DOCTYPE. Объявление указывает браузеру версию языка разметки. Нынешние страницы используютhtmlдля определения стандарта HTML5.

Главный элемент html охватывает всё контент документа. Атрибут lang определяет язык страницы для поисковых систем. Верное определение языка повышает доступность и индексацию ресурса.

Блок head включает метаинформацию о странице. Внутри располагаются теги meta, title, link для присоединения стилей. Кодировка UTF-8 обеспечивает корректное воспроизведение знаков. Название title показывается во закладке браузера и результатах поиска.

Элемент body включает весь видимый материал страницы. Пользователь наблюдает только содержимое этого секции в окне браузера. Специалисты располагают текст, картинки, формы внутри Казино Платинум.

Основной образец страницы является стартовой точкой для разработок. Валидная организация гарантирует совместимость с разными браузерами. Грамотная организация кода облегчает последующую разработку и обслуживание.

Фундаментальные HTML‑теги: заголовки, абзацы, линки, изображения и перечни

Названия от h1 до h6 организуют структуру содержимого на странице. Тег h1 указывает центральный название и применяется единожды раз. Дальнейшие уровни создают иерархическую структуру секций. Поисковые системы исследуют названия для определения тематики.

Тег p образует текстовые абзацы и является главным элементом для расположения контента. Браузер самостоятельно создаёт отступы сверху и снизу. Разделение текста на абзацы увеличивает восприятие.

Ссылки образуются тегом a с обязательным атрибутом href. Адрес может указывать на внешний источник или якорь внутри страницы. Атрибут target со параметром _blank открывает гиперссылку в новой вкладке.

Тег img вставляет картинки в документ. Атрибут src включает маршрут к файлу изображения. Замещающий текст в атрибуте alt представляет картинку для Platinum Casino и поддерживающих технологий.

Маркированные перечни ul включают элементы li без заданного последовательности. Пронумерованные перечни ol выводят элементы с цифрами. Списки помогают упорядочить сведения в комфортном формате для восприятия.

Семантическая разметка: header, nav, main, section, article, footer

Семантические теги наделяют содержательное значение секциям страницы. Браузеры и поисковые системы лучше распознают построение документа. Использование корректных тегов повышает доступность для людей с ограниченными способностями.

Тег header определяет вводную секцию страницы или блока. Внутри размещается логотип, навигация, заголовок сайта. Каждая страница может включать множество элементов header.

Элемент nav предназначен для навигационных ссылок. Меню ресурса, оглавление, хлебные крошки располагаются внутри этого тега. Скринридеры задействуют nav для оперативного навигации по Платинум Казино.

Главные семантические контейнеры:

  • main хранит эксклюзивный контент страницы
  • section объединяет смыслово взаимосвязанное наполнение
  • article представляет независимую публикацию
  • footer охватывает сведения об авторе, копирайт, связи

Корректная смысловая разметка формирует стройную построение документа. Поисковые краулеры продуктивнее индексируют страницы с содержательными тегами. Программисты проще разбираются в коде при употреблении семантических элементов.

Что такое CSS: подключение стилей и базовые выборщики (элемент, класс, id)

CSS задаёт графическое отображение HTML-элементов на странице. Каскадные таблицы стилей дают контролировать цветом, величиной, размещением материала. Разделение оформления и построения облегчает разработку проекта.

Существует три способа подключения стилей к документу. Сторонний документ CSS присоединяется через тег link в секции head. Внутренние стили располагаются в теге style. Inline стили записываются в атрибут style элемента.

Выборщик элемента выбирает все теги конкретного типа на странице. Запись p color: blue; применит синий цвет ко всем абзацам. Такой метод практичен для общего стилизации.

Классы позволяют стилизовать группу элементов с схожими свойствами. Атрибут class прикрепляется тегам, а в Platinum Casino выборщик стартует с точки. Один элемент способен иметь множество классов через интервал.

Идентификатор id обозначает неповторимый элемент на странице. Выборщик id стартует с знака решётки в таблице стилей. Каждый идентификатор применяется только один раз в документе. Приоритет стилей id больше, чем у классов и выборщиков элементов.

Фундаментальные свойства CSS: цвет, шрифты, интервалы и взаимодействие с текстом

Параметр color определяет цвет текста элемента. Значения указываются в видах hex, rgb, rgba или названиями цветов. Свойство background-color устанавливает задний цвет элемента. Правильный соотношение увеличивает восприятие контента.

Гарнитура гарнитур задаётся через font-family. Советуется задавать множество альтернатив через запятую. Браузер выберет начальный наличный гарнитуру из перечня. Величина текста контролируется атрибутом font-size в пикселях или процентах.

Атрибут font-weight контролирует насыщенностью гарнитуры. Значения записываются числами от 100 до 900 или текстовыми normal и bold. Курсивное начертание задаётся через font-style со параметром italic.

Выравнивание текста устанавливается свойством text-align с вариантами left, right, center, justify. Межстрочное расстояние контролируется через line-height. Оформление текста text-decoration вносит подчёркивание или зачёркивание в Казино Платинум.

Внешние интервалы margin образуют пространство вокруг элемента. Внутренние интервалы padding образуют промежуток между краем и контентом. Параметры прописываются для всех сторон сразу или отдельно для каждой края.

Модель коробки (box model): content, padding, border, margin и границы

Модель бокса характеризует организацию каждого элемента на веб-странице. Каждый блок формируется из четырёх областей: наполнения, внутреннего отступа, обводки и внешнего интервала. Понимание модели важно для контроля размерами элементов.

Зона content хранит реальное наполнение: текст, рисунки или вложенные элементы. Ширина и высота устанавливаются атрибутами width и height. По дефолту эти параметры задают лишь размер наполнения.

Внутренний отступ padding образует пространство между наполнением и границей элемента. Атрибут принимает значения для каждой стороны индивидуально или единое для всех сторон. Увеличение padding расширяет общий величину блока.

Граница border обрамляет элемент видимой линией. Атрибут border объединяет толщину, тип и цвет рамки. Доступны разнообразные типы: solid, dashed, dotted и другие опции в Платинум Казино.

Внешний интервал margin устанавливает интервал между блоками на странице. Отрицательные параметры margin сближают элементы. Параметр box-sizing со значением border-box включает padding и border в заданные width и height.

Основания построения: инлайновые и блочные элементы, flexbox/простая верстка для начинающих

HTML-элементы делятся на блочные и строчные по типу представления. Блочные элементы занимают всю доступную ширину и открываются с новой линии. Строчные элементы находятся в потоке текста и занимают только нужное пространство.

Атрибут display модифицирует вид визуализации элемента. Значение block трансформирует элемент в блочный, а inline делает строчным. Параметр inline-block сочетает характеристики обоих видов.

Flexbox обеспечивает средство для создания гибких макетов. Блок с display: flex трансформирует вложенные элементы в flex-элементы. Ориентация ориентации задаётся параметром flex-direction.

Ключевые параметры flexbox для позиционирования:

  • justify-content позиционирует элементы по основной линии
  • align-items управляет позиционированием по вторичной линии
  • flex-wrap даёт элементам переноситься на свежую строку
  • gap создаёт отступы между flex-элементами

Базовая верстка стартует с понимания потока документа. Элементы выстраиваются сверху вниз и слева направо. Flexbox облегчает создание гибких макетов в Platinum Casino.

Упражнение для новичков: построение элементарной страницы и поэтапное улучшение с средствами CSS

Построение первой веб-страницы стартует с базового образца. Документ включает декларацию DOCTYPE, блоки head и body с минимальным контентом. Простая страница охватывает заголовок, абзацы текста и картинку.

Стартовый шаг стилизации — подсоединение стороннего документа CSS к документу. Сформируйте документ styles.css и подключите его через тег link. Начните с фундаментальных настроек: установите гарнитуру для страницы и цвет заднего body.

Следующий стадия — дизайн типографики и цветовой гаммы. Установите габариты и оттенки названий, установите интерлиньяж расстояние для абзацев. Внесите контрастные оттенки для увеличения восприятия.

Взаимодействие с интервалами создаёт зрительную структуру. Определите максимальную ширину обёртки и отцентрируйте контент через margin: auto. Примените внутренние отбивки padding вокруг элементов в Казино Платинум.

Заключительные улучшения содержат оформление ссылок и hover-эффектов. Смените оттенок гиперссылок и уберите подчёркивание. Задействуйте border-radius для скругления углов изображений. Пробуйте с различными свойствами для понимания их воздействия.

Leave a Comment

Your email address will not be published. Required fields are marked *